Annotation. A brushless DC (BLDC) motors diagnostics system based on the model approach in the state space is developed. A digital twin representing a model of BLDC motor and working in parallel with a real BLDC motor is designed. The BLDC motor are analyses using electric current and angular velocity sensors signals and the output signals of the digital twin. Based on the magnitude of the residual, the presence of defects in the real BLDC motor is determined. If the defect value is insignificant, then appropriate maintenance actions are recommended. In case when the defect value is significant, it is necessary to perform emergency termination of the engine operation.
